Rublev Colours Turpentine & Mineral Spirits Recall
Natural Pigments Recalls Rublev Colours Gum Turpentine and Mineral Spirits Bottles Due to Risk of Serious Injury or Death from Child Poisoning; Violates Mandatory Standard for Child-Resistant Packaging
Updated May 7, 2026
Natural Pigments is recalling Rublev Colours Gum Turpentine and Mineral Spirits bottles because the bottles are not child-resistant as required by law. If a young child swallows the contents, which contain turpentine or low-viscosity hydrocarbons, it could cause serious injury or death.

What is recalled
Rublev Colours Gum Turpentine and Mineral Spirits, sold in amber glass bottles with a beige, orange, and white label. Labels read "Rublev Colours" in white lettering, and bottles are marked "Gum Turpentine" / "Distilled Spirits of Gum Turpentine" or "Mineral Spirits" / "Stoddard Solvent."
Am I affected
You're affected if you own any amber glass bottle of Rublev Colours Gum Turpentine (also labeled "Distilled Spirits of Gum Turpentine") or Rublev Colours Mineral Spirits (also labeled "Stoddard Solvent") with a beige, orange, and white label showing "Rublev Colours" in white lettering. Check the label for those exact product names.
What to do right now
Right now, move the bottles somewhere completely out of sight and reach of any young children. Then contact Natural Pigments to get a free replacement in child-resistant packaging or a full refund. You will need to submit a photo of the product, share your contact details, and confirm you have disposed of the contents before your replacement or refund is processed. The hazard
The gum turpentine and mineral spirits contain turpentine and low-viscosity hydrocarbons, respectively, which must be in child-resistant packaging, as required by the Poison Prevention Packaging Act. The bottles are not child-resistant, posing a risk of serious injury or death from poisoning if the contents are swallowed by young children.
